JUSTICE AJAY KUMAR TRIPATHI and HONOURABLE JUSTICE SMT. NILU AGRAWAL ORAL ORDER (Per: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E AJAY KUMAR TRIPATHI) 04-02-2017 I.A. No.9115 of 2015, which is a petition for condonation, is allowed on the ground explained in the limitation petition.
The matter is thereafter taken up on merits.
After some arguments, learned counsel for the appellant submits that he may be given liberty to take recourse to law before the appropriate forum having jurisdiction. The learned Single Judge has any way disposed of the writ application with an observation that the law as considered and decided in CWJC No.7736 of 2014, disposed of on
Patna High Court LPA No.2067 of 2015 (3) dt.04-02-2017 2/2 22.7.2014, which was the case of M/s Shiv Industries v. State of Bihar & others, will govern the issue.
Nothing further is required to be said or done with the order impugned because it is in consonance with the previous adjudication.
Appeal is dismissed with liberty as above.
